Bible Verses About Father and Daughter Relationships

Love and Affection

In understanding Bible verses about father and daughter relationships, we find that love and affection are the foundation. Fathers are called to show love to their daughters, nurturing them with warmth and kindness. Through affectionate gestures, words of encouragement, and showing appreciation, fathers can create an environment where their daughters feel valued and cherished. As we explore these scriptures, we are reminded that expressing love is vital for building a strong relationship. It cultivates trust and emotional security, allowing daughters to grow into confident and loving individuals.

Colossians 3:21

“Fathers, do not embitter your children, or they will become discouraged.” – Colossians 3:21

Ephesians 6:4

“Fathers, do not provoke your children to anger, but bring them up in the discipline and instruction of the Lord.” – Ephesians 6:4

1 John 3:1

“See what great love the Father has lavished on us, that we should be called children of God! And that is what we are!” – 1 John 3:1

Proverbs 3:12

“Because the Lord disciplines those he loves, as a father the son he delights in.” – Proverbs 3:12

Luke 11:13

“If you then, though you are evil, know how to give good gifts to your children, how much more will your Father in heaven give the Holy Spirit to those who ask him!” – Luke 11:13

Guidance and Wisdom

We also see that guidance and wisdom are essential in father-daughter relationships as highlighted in various Bible verses. A father has a vital role in guiding his daughter through life’s challenges, helping her make wise decisions and navigate her path. The Bible encourages fathers to impart wisdom, share life lessons, and help daughters build their character and integrity. Through this mentorship, fathers instill strong values in their daughters that shape their futures. Thus, the balance of guidance with love creates a nurturing environment for growth and learning.

Proverbs 22:6

“Start children off on the way they should go, and even when they are old they will not turn from it.” – Proverbs 22:6

Proverbs 4:1

“Listen, my sons, to a father’s instruction; pay attention and gain understanding.” – Proverbs 4:1

Proverbs 1:8

“Listen, my son, to your father’s instruction and do not forsake your mother’s teaching.” – Proverbs 1:8

James 1:5

“If any of you lacks wisdom, you should ask God, who gives generously to all without finding fault, and it will be given to you.” – James 1:5

Psalm 32:8

“I will instruct you and teach you in the way you should go; I will counsel you with my loving eye on you.” – Psalm 32:8

Protection and Safety

Another essential aspect we find in Bible verses about father and daughter relationships is the need for protection and safety. Fathers have a natural instinct to shield their daughters from harm, whether it be physical, emotional, or spiritual. This protective nature allows daughters to feel safe and secure, enabling them to explore the world without fear. The Bible highlights the importance of a father’s role in creating a safe space where daughters can express themselves, seek comfort, and feel loved. Ultimately, this protection fosters a strong bond filled with trust and reassurance.

Proverbs 14:26

“Whoever fears the Lord has a secure fortress, and for their children, it will be a refuge.” – Proverbs 14:26

Psalm 91:4

“He will cover you with his feathers, and under his wings, you will find refuge; his faithfulness will be your shield and rampart.” – Psalm 91:4

1 Peter 5:7

“Cast all your anxiety on him because he cares for you.” – 1 Peter 5:7

Proverbs 18:10

“The name of the Lord is a fortified tower; the righteous run to it and are safe.” – Proverbs 18:10

Psalms 121:7-8

“The Lord will keep you from all harm— he will watch over your life; the Lord will watch over your coming and going both now and forevermore.” – Psalms 121:7-8

Faith and Spirituality

Faith and spirituality are cornerstones of father-daughter relationships that inspire growth, purpose, and understanding. As fathers guide their daughters along their spiritual journeys, they help instill values that connect them to God. The Bible encourages fathers to share their faith and be role models in prayer, worship, and seeking God’s wisdom. Nurturing a solid foundation of faith not only fosters a strong relationship but also ensures that daughters have the spiritual tools they need to navigate life’s challenges confidently. Together, fathers and daughters can experience God’s love and grace through their bond.

Deuteronomy 6:6-7

“These commandments that I give you today are to be on your hearts. Impress them on your children. Talk about them when you sit at home and when you walk along the road, when you lie down and when you get up.” – Deuteronomy 6:6-7

Psalm 78:4

“We will not hide them from their descendants; we will tell the next generation the praiseworthy deeds of the Lord, his power, and the wonders he has done.” – Psalm 78:4

Matthew 19:14

“Jesus said, ‘Let the little children come to me, and do not hinder them, for the kingdom of heaven belongs to such as these.'” – Matthew 19:14

Proverbs 3:5-6

“Trust in the Lord with all your heart and lean not on your own understanding; in all your ways submit to him, and he will make your paths straight.” – Proverbs 3:5-6

Isaiah 54:13

“All your children will be taught by the Lord, and great will be their peace.” – Isaiah 54:13
